Antony Daly calls us from 586 Records in Newcastle, with a playlist that includes A Certain Ratio, in tribute to a "glorious, kind and loyal soul" Graeme Cartwright.

Today’s castaway Antony Daly calls us from 586 Records in Newcastle, keeping his customers at bay until he’s chatted to Lauren.

Antony wanted to share some excellent tunes and pay tribute to Graeme Cartwright, a charismatic figure from Newcastle’s music scene and a “true, glorious, kind and loyal soul” whose wake is to be held at The Cluny today.

A mutual friend, Michaela Johnson, tells us more: “I met Graeme at The Palace at The Riverside some 20+ years ago. He DJ’d along with Matt Moir and it had a profound effect on me. I had no idea just how much it would at the time but he’d regularly hark back to the days where “a little gobby lass used to bool on up to the DJ booth and start telling, not asking, TELLING, me what to play...annoying thing was, y’were aaaaalways bloody right though!”

We were there for each other, no matter what, and once I moved in a few streets down from him this could sometimes be lethal! Any gig, night, event or party would be greatly improved by his presence and after parties were often more extensive affairs.

We could sit and listen to music forever. We both love to be surprised and relished each other’s recommendations. Putting together the playlist for his celebration of life has not been hard at all. He lived and breathed music and many of our memories are centred around music.

He was keen to get me to meet everyone he knew and loved and given just how many people this was, I was out and about A LOT! He’d trot me about like a show pony saying ‘aaaaah Michela this is insert name you’ll LOVVVVVVVVVVVE them!’ He was never wrong and widened my friendship circle, introducing me to many great friends I’ll have for life.

He was one of the best people I’ve ever met. A warm, witty, super knowledgeable, kind, intelligent, loud, anarchic, hilarious, caring bag of bother. I’m so glad I badgered the living daylights out of him at The Palace and ended up partying with him because he’s brought so much to my life.

Cartwright Forever! X”
